Professor Thuli Madonsela, the former Public Protector of South Africa, has shared her ongoing grief five months after the death of her beloved husband, Richard Edward Foxton.

Mr Foxton, affectionately known as Dick, passed away peacefully at the age of 82 on 21 June.

He was a respected figure, known as the visionary founder of the ethical communication firm, Foxton Communicating, as well as a devoted father and grandfather of nine.

Taking to social media to mark the five-month anniversary of his passing, Professor Madonsela described the profound impact of her loss.

“Today marks 5 months since the lifequake unleashed on my life by the sudden passing of my life partner… yet sometimes it still feels like a nightmare that I will wake up from,” she posted.

Since becoming a widow, Professor Madonsela has regularly paid tribute to Mr Foxton, including holding an intimate celebration in September on what would have been his 83rd birthday.
